Output 3c7590015dbd72964a1dd46816577661a0d08e2525b9a3c768a68141596bb767:13

value
681219
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 47451809f83274c0ca540a19d7fd89265b5e853c OP_EQUALVERIFY OP_CHECKSIG
address
17VqkMDAADikAtDjuA1Dn4rvoBqpqR96SU
transaction
3c7590015dbd72964a1dd46816577661a0d08e2525b9a3c768a68141596bb767
spent
true